The www-data user is a system user that is used by web servers to serve content to websites. By default, the www-data user has read and write permissions to the /var/www directory, which is where web server content is stored. What is www-data? The www-data user is a system user that is used by web servers to serve content to websites. The www-data user is typically created during the installation of a web server, such as Apache or Nginx. The www-data user has read and write permissions to the /var/www directory, which is where web server content is stored. This allows the web server to read and write files to the /var/www directory without having to provide write permissions to other users. Purpose of www-data. The purpose of the www-data user is to provide a way for web servers to serve content to websites without having to provide write permissions to other users. This is important for security reasons, as it prevents unauthorized users from being able to write files to the /var/www directory. Typical permissions of www-data.
